#85650b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#85650b is composed of 52.2% red, 39.6%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.1% magenta, 91.7%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 44.3 degrees, a saturation of 84.7% and a lightness of 28.2%. #85650b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ffca16 with #0b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

Shades and Tints of #85650b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060501 is the darkest color, while #fefbf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#85650b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#484848 is the less saturated color, while #8b6805 is the most saturated one.
